Armed bandits on Sunday attacked a religious gathering in Kusa Town, Musawa Local Government Area of Katsina State.
The attackers, armed with AK-47 rifles, stormed the Maulud procession, firing indiscriminately at attendees.
The Katsina State Police Command confirmed that seven people lost their lives and 16 others sustained gunshot injuries during the attack.
A swift response from law enforcement agents led to the repelling of the attackers.
In the wake of the assault, injured victims were rushed to nearby hospitals for medical treatment.
Katsina State Governor, Dikko Radda, visited the affected community to express his condolences and assure residents of the government’s commitment to restoring peace.
The governor’s visit was met with gratitude by the villagers, who appreciated his support during this difficult time.
As investigations continue, the community mourns the loss of their loved ones, noting the need for increased security measures to prevent future tragedies.
